In 2026, having a strong digital presence is no longer optional — it’s essential. The way people discover, research, and interact with businesses has shifted almost entirely online. If your business isn’t visible on digital platforms, you’re missing out on opportunities, customers, and revenue.
Here’s why every business needs a strong digital presence in 2026.
More than 80% of consumers research online before making a purchase. Whether it’s finding a local restaurant, buying electronics, or hiring a service, people turn to Google, social media, and review sites first.
Example: If your business doesn’t appear in Google search results or on social platforms, your competitors will capture your potential customers.
A professional website, active social media profiles, and positive reviews build trust. People are more likely to buy from brands that look credible online.
Pro Tip: Even small businesses can appear professional online with a clean website, Google Business Profile, and active social media presence.
